RSA 261:24 Perfecting of Security Interest.
Title: XXI - MOTOR VEHICLES
Chapter: 261 - CERTIFICATES OF TITLE AND REGISTRATION OF VEHICLES
I. Unless excepted by RSA 261:23, a security interest in a vehicle of a type for which a certificate of title is required is not valid against creditors of the owner or subsequent transferees or lienholders of the vehicle unless perfected as provided in this chapter.
II. A security interest is perfected by the delivery to the department of the existing certificate of title, if any, an application for a certificate of title containing the name and address of the lienholder and the date of his security agreement and the required fee. It is perfected as of the time of its creation if delivery is completed within 20 days thereafter, otherwise as of the time of the delivery.
